Finding the Right Neighborhood for Your Gilbert Rental

Gilbert offers a diverse range of neighborhoods, each with its own unique character and advantages. Choosing the right neighborhood is a crucial step in your rental search. Our experience shows that factors like proximity to work, schools, and amenities play a significant role in your satisfaction. Some of the most popular neighborhoods for rentals in Gilbert include:

  • Val Vista Lakes: Known for its beautiful lakes, community events, and well-maintained properties.
  • Power Ranch: A master-planned community with a strong sense of community and numerous parks and recreational facilities.
  • Seville: Offers a mix of housing options, including apartments, townhomes, and single-family homes, along with a golf course.
  • Downtown Gilbert: A vibrant area with a variety of restaurants, shops, and entertainment options within walking distance. According to recent data from the Gilbert Chamber of Commerce, downtown Gilbert has seen a significant increase in residential development over the past five years.

Understanding Rental Costs in Gilbert, AZ

The cost of renting in Gilbert, AZ, varies depending on several factors, including the type of property, the size of the unit, and the location. It's essential to understand the current rental market and budget accordingly. Generally, you can expect to pay anywhere from $1,500 to $3,000+ per month for rentals in Gilbert, AZ. Our research indicates that the average rent has steadily increased over the past few years due to high demand and limited supply. It's important to be aware of these trends to be prepared.

Factors Affecting Rental Prices

Several factors influence the rental prices in Gilbert, AZ:

  • Property Type: Apartments, townhomes, and single-family homes have varying price points.
  • Size and Features: Larger units with more features will typically cost more.
  • Location: Neighborhoods with desirable amenities and convenient locations often command higher rents.
  • Market Conditions: Supply and demand in the rental market can impact prices.

Budgeting for Your Rental

Beyond the monthly rent, be sure to factor in additional costs when budgeting for your rental. According to Zillow, additional costs can include:

  • Security Deposit: Typically equal to one or two months' rent.
  • Application Fees: Fees to cover the cost of background and credit checks.
  • Pet Fees (If Applicable): Non-refundable fees or monthly pet rent.
  • Utilities: Costs for electricity, water, gas, and trash collection.
  • Renters Insurance: Protects your belongings from theft or damage.

Navigating Lease Agreements

Understanding the terms of your lease agreement is crucial to avoid any misunderstandings or disputes during your tenancy. Before signing a lease, carefully review all the terms and conditions and ask for clarification on any items you don't fully understand. According to the Arizona Department of Housing, a lease agreement is a legally binding contract between the landlord and the tenant.

Key Lease Agreement Terms

  • Rent Amount and Due Date: Clearly states the monthly rent and the date it is due.
  • Lease Term: Specifies the duration of the lease (e.g., one year).
  • Security Deposit: Outlines the amount of the security deposit and the conditions for its return.
  • Pet Policies: Details the rules regarding pets, including any fees or restrictions.
  • Maintenance Responsibilities: Defines the responsibilities of the landlord and tenant regarding maintenance and repairs.

Questions to Ask Before Signing

  • Are there any restrictions on guests?
  • What are the procedures for requesting repairs?
  • What are the consequences of breaking the lease?
  • What are the policies regarding utilities?

Q: What is the average rent for an apartment in Gilbert, AZ? A: The average rent for an apartment in Gilbert, AZ, varies depending on the size and location, but generally ranges from $1,700 to $2,800 per month.

Q: How do I find rental properties in Gilbert? A: You can find rental properties through online listing websites, local real estate agents, and by driving around neighborhoods you like and looking for “For Rent” signs.

Q: What documents do I need to apply for a rental? A: You'll typically need to provide proof of income, identification, and references.

Q: What is a security deposit, and how does it work? A: A security deposit is a sum of money held by the landlord to cover potential damages to the property or unpaid rent. It is typically returned to the tenant at the end of the lease term, minus any deductions for damages.

Q: Are pets allowed in Gilbert rentals? A: Pet policies vary by property. Some rentals allow pets, while others do not. If pets are allowed, there may be restrictions on size, breed, and the number of pets.

Q: Is Gilbert a safe place to live? A: Yes, Gilbert is known for being a safe city with low crime rates. The Gilbert Police Department consistently works to maintain safety.
